A retail hackerspace providing public access to 3D printers, laser cutters, and other digital fabrication tools for prototyping and one-off projects.

Technology & Products

Key Products

3D printing services; Laser cutting/etching services; Electronics prototyping; Workshops/events; Tool rentals; Vending machine with snacks/electronics

Technological Advantage

Low-cost access to multiple fabrication technologies under one roof; community-driven model with workshops fostering user engagement.

Differentiation

Value Proposition

Enables affordable, on-demand access to advanced prototyping tools (3D printing, laser cutting, electronics) without capital investment, reducing project lead times from weeks to hours.

How They Differentiate

Offered a retail storefront with vending machine and walk-in rates, unlike many members-only makerspaces; located in a high-traffic urban area (Capitol Hill, Seattle).

Growth & Milestones

Growth Metrics

Metrix Create:Space closed its doors to the public in 2018 after operating for about 9 years, with historical membership pricing including Basic Membership at $50/month, tools at $2/hour, and soldering room at $12/hour.

Major Milestones

Founded in 2009; Closed to public in 2018; Operated for ~9 years as a community makerspace
